Subsea Cable Class of 2026: Echo

Image
The Echo cable is a 12 fibre network directly linking Singapore to California with with a Guam branching unit. Bifrost, the other cable connecting Singapore and the US, also lands in Bifrost. I believe each cable effectively serves as backup for the other because traffic can be rerouted at Guam. Both cables are only 12 fibre pairs due to the great distances involved. Its design capacity is 260 Tbps. A key feature of both Bifrost and Echo is they bypass the South China Sea even though it is part of the shortest path between Singapore and the US West Coast. Hence Chinese permits are avoided, resiliency is improved since most Intra-Asian traffic traverses the South China Sea, and the cable is more protected from Chinese tapping or attack. However, it does come as a price. The cable must be buried quite deep through the shallow Indonesian waters to minimize fishing boat or anchor damage. Subsea Cable Class of 2027: JAKO

Image
JAKO is a high capacity cable connecting Korea and Japan via a Busan, Korea, and a Fukuoka, Japan landing. Busan is a major Korean cable landing spot. Nine cables including JAKO land in Busan. The cable's consortium consists of Microsoft, Amazon, Arteria (important Japanese back haul carrier), and the Korean Dreamline company. Dreamline is a Korean carrier that provides tower services, metro and long haul connectivity. It is increasingly common for hyperscalers to team up with competitive carriers in Asia because the regional PTTs are viewed as difficult, slow to make decisions, and too concerned about protecting their home turf. Uncooperative is hyperscaler diplomatic language to describe the telecom incumbents. NTT is an exception to this generalization. Obviously this cable reflects Microsoft and Amazon's cloud and AI ambitions. No public information is available on the number of fibre pairs.
